Output 1ecb8c40556303799e8a1f92a2c1e3991cd6d7324a6b9c93ccf81bfa420fe4d7:2

value
169735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d508517ead0404b0a0e037ec987f6d5b1c5e8c OP_EQUAL
address
3QC9MVSaUnJBPssFejrmKtxEJVpJ94MNDs
transaction
1ecb8c40556303799e8a1f92a2c1e3991cd6d7324a6b9c93ccf81bfa420fe4d7
spent
true